OU vs. UT Austin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, OU or UT Austin?

  • The University of Texas at Austin is 137.8% more expensive to attend than OU for in-state tuition ($11,698.00 vs. $4,920.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 91.1% higher at UT Austin than University of Oklahoma Norman Campus ($41,070.00 vs. $21,488.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at The University of Texas at Austin than OU ($17,434 vs. $22,601)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at The University of Texas at Austin are 20.8% lower than costs at University of Oklahoma Norman Campus ($13,058 vs. $15,780)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at University of Oklahoma Norman Campus than The University of Texas at Austin (98% vs. 86%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by University of Oklahoma Norman Campus students is 26.9% larger than aid received The University of Texas at Austin ($10,561 vs. $8,321)

OU vs. UT Austin Admissions Difficulty Comparison

Which college is harder to get into, OU or UT Austin? Average SAT and ACT scores plus acceptance rates offer good insight into the difficulty of admission between UT Austin or OU .

  • The average SAT score at The University of Texas at Austin (1297) is 93 points higher than at OU (1204)
  • Incoming UT Austin students have a 2 point higher average ACT score (29) than students at OU (27)
  • Accepted freshman UT Austin students have a 0.14 point higher average high school GPA (3.8) than students at OU (3.66)
  • OU has a higher acceptance rate (72.9%) than UT Austin (31.4%)

OU vs. UT Austin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, OU or UT Austin?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between UT Austin and OU.

  • The graduation rate at UT Austin is higher than University of Oklahoma Norman Campus (81% vs. 67%)
  • Graduates from The University of Texas at Austin earn on average $9,300 more per year than OU graduates after ten years. ($68,600 vs. $59,300)
  • University of Oklahoma Norman Campus students graduate with a $2,250 lower median federal student loan debt than UT Austin graduates. ($20,000 vs. $22,250)
  • OU graduates are paying $24 less per month on federal student loans than UT Austin graduates. ($206 vs. $230)
  • More UT Austin gra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former OU students, three years after graduation. (77% vs. 68%)
